Self-care and wellness

Self-care is the practice of taking deliberate actions to prioritize and maintain one’s physical, mental, and emotional well-being. It involves activities that help individuals recharge, relax, and nurture themselves, leading to overall improved health and quality of life.
Examples of Self-care Practices for Mental and Emotional Health
- Engaging in mindfulness meditation to reduce stress and increase self-awareness.
- Taking breaks throughout the day to rest and recharge, promoting mental clarity and focus.
- Setting boundaries with others to protect emotional energy and prevent burnout.
- Practicing gratitude by keeping a journal of things you are thankful for, promoting a positive mindset.
- Engaging in hobbies and activities that bring joy and fulfillment, fostering emotional well-being.
Benefits of Incorporating Self-care Routines into Daily Life
- Improved mental health: Regular self-care practices can reduce symptoms of anxiety and depression, promoting emotional stability.
- Enhanced productivity: Taking time to care for oneself can boost energy levels and focus, leading to increased efficiency in daily tasks.
- Increased resilience: Self-care routines help individuals cope with stress and adversity, building emotional strength and adaptability.
- Better relationships: When individuals prioritize self-care, they are better able to show up fully in their relationships and communicate effectively.
- Overall well-being: Consistent self-care leads to a healthier and more balanced life, improving both physical and emotional health in the long run.
Health and Safety at Work Act
The Health and Safety at Work Act is a crucial piece of legislation that sets out the duties that employers have to ensure the health, safety, and welfare of their employees in the workplace. It also Artikels the responsibilities of employees to take care of their own health and safety and that of others who may be affected by their actions at work.
Key Provisions of the Health and Safety at Work Act:
- Employers must provide a safe working environment for their employees, including safe premises, machinery, and equipment.
- Employees have the right to be informed about potential workplace hazards and receive adequate training to carry out their work safely.
- Employers must conduct risk assessments to identify and address any potential risks to health and safety in the workplace.
- There should be adequate provisions for first aid and medical facilities in case of emergencies.
- Employers must have a written health and safety policy in place and consult with employees on health and safety matters.
Examples of Ensuring Compliance with Health and Safety Regulations:
- Regular safety inspections and audits to identify and rectify any hazards in the workplace.
- Providing employees with app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) for their specific roles.
- Implementing health and safety training programs for employees to raise awareness and promote safe working practices.
- Encouraging employees to report any health and safety concerns or incidents promptly.
Importance of Creating a Safe Work Environment for Employee Well-being:
Creating a safe work environment is not only a legal requirement but also essential for the well-being and productivity of employees. A safe workplace reduces the risk of accidents, injuries, and illnesses, leading to a happier and more motivated workforce. Moreover, promoting a culture of safety fosters trust and loyalty among employees, enhancing overall job satisfaction and retention rates.

Weight loss surgery
Weight loss surgery, also known as bariatric surgery, is a medical procedure that helps individuals lose weight by making changes to their digestive system. There are different types of weight loss surgeries available, each with its own set of risks and benefits.
Types of Weight Loss Surgeries
- Gastric Bypass: This procedure involves creating a small pouch from the stomach and connecting it directly to the small intestine, bypassing a section of the stomach and the small intestine.
- Gastric Sleeve: In this surgery, a large portion of the stomach is removed, leaving a smaller sleeve-shaped stomach behind.
- Gastric Band: A band is placed around the upper part of the stomach, creating a small pouch that limits the amount of food the stomach can hold.
Risks and Benefits
- Risks: Some risks associated with weight loss surgery include infection, blood clots, nutritional deficiencies, and gallstones. It is important to discuss these risks with your healthcare provider before undergoing surgery.
- Benefits: Weight loss surgery can lead to significant weight loss, improvement in obesity-related conditions such as diabetes and high blood pressure, and an overall improvement in quality of life.
Post-operative Care and Lifestyle Changes
- Follow your healthcare provider’s instructions carefully regarding diet, exercise, and medication after surgery.
- Attend regular follow-up appointments to monitor your progress and address any concerns.
- Make healthy lifestyle changes, including eating a balanced diet and staying physically active, to maintain weight loss in the long term.
Health and wellness
Maintaining good health and wellness involves taking a holistic approach that considers the well-being of the body, mind, and spirit. This comprehensive approach focuses on prevention, self-care, and healthy lifestyle choices to achieve overall well-being.
What encompasses a holistic approach to health and wellness
A holistic approach to health and wellness considers the interconnectedness of the body, mind, and spirit. It emphasizes the importance of addressing physical, mental, emotional, and spiritual aspects of health to achieve balance and harmony. This approach recognizes that each individual is unique and requires personalized care that takes into account their specific needs and goals.
- Physical well-being: Regular exercise, balanced nutrition, and adequate rest are essential for maintaining physical health.
- Mental well-being: Managing stress, practicing mindfulness, and seeking support when needed are crucial for mental health.
- Emotional well-being: Building healthy relationships, expressing emotions, and engaging in activities that bring joy and fulfillment contribute to emotional well-being.
- Spiritual well-being: Connecting with a higher purpose, practicing gratitude, and engaging in activities that nurture the soul support spiritual well-being.
Tips for maintaining a healthy lifestyle through diet and exercise
Eating a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ins is key to supporting overall health. Incorporating regular physical activity into your routine, such as walking, jogging, or yoga, helps maintain a healthy weight and promotes cardiovascular health. Staying hydrated, getting enough sleep, and avoiding harmful substances like tobacco and excessive alcohol also play a crucial role in maintaining a healthy lifestyle.
The importance of mental well-being in overall health and wellness
Mental well-being is essential for overall health and wellness as it impacts how we think, feel, and act in our daily lives. Prioritizing mental health through self-care practices, therapy, and stress management techniques can improve mood, enhance relationships, and boost resilience. Taking care of our mental well-being not only benefits our psychological health but also contributes to our physical health and overall quality of life.
